    After completion of this course, learners will be able to explain the basic components of state and tribal implementation plans (SIPs and TIPs) that are common for attaining any of the national ambient air quality standards (NAAQS). It is recommended, but not required, that learners take the following modules and/or courses before taking this course:

    What are Criteria Pollutants module
    BASC110-SI: Introduction to the National Ambient Air Quality Standards (NAAQS)
    BASC111-SI: Introduction to NAAQS Implementation
    This course consists of 8 lessons covering the following components:

    A detailed emissions inventory
    Identification of existing emission reduction measures
    Evaluation of potential new emission reduction measures
    Air quality modeling for the attainment demonstration
    Adoption of enforceable emission reduction measures
    Permitting programs
    A plan for reasonable further progress (RFP)
    Contingency measures
